A projector from Optoma is the PRO260X, whose 3D-BrilliantColor-DLP model delivers 3000 ANSI lumens, a resolution of XGA 1024 x 768 and a contrast of 3000:1. In operating mode, the installed projector lamp offers a lifespan of 3000 hours. Looking at practical performance, up to 477 cm can be illuminated with 3000 ANSI lumens in dark environments. Once daylight is in the room, the image should ideally be no wider than 318 cm. Regarding signal processing, the model is compatible with incoming 1080P content. Since entering the market in 2011, production has been discontinued; the manufacturer no longer actively offers the model.
